This 1996 Chevrolet C/K 3500 Series K3500 Silverado Regular Cab is a heavy-duty pickup from the final years of the GMT400 generation. The Silverado trim places it above the more basic work-oriented versions, while the K3500 designation identifies the four-wheel-drive one-ton chassis. The Regular Cab body keeps the interior simple and direct, with seating arranged for straightforward use and a shorter cabin than extended-cab versions. Chevrolet's mid-1990s truck design used broad surfaces, squared proportions, and an upright front end, all of which gave the series a familiar appearance during its production run. The body style was offered during a period when these trucks were commonly selected for demanding towing, hauling, and commercial duties, and the 3500 series sat at the upper end of the light-duty Chevrolet range before the larger medium-duty trucks.

Mechanical strength defined the K3500 series, and the one-ton rating gave this Chevrolet a place near the top of the consumer pickup hierarchy of its day. Four-wheel drive added traction for surfaces where added grip was needed, and the chassis was built to handle heavier loads than lighter C/K models. The 3500 designation also brought a stouter frame and running gear compared with half-ton and three-quarter-ton variants, along with hardware chosen for greater durability under repeated use. Chevrolet offered these trucks with powertrain combinations suited to labor-intensive work, and the platform was known for its serviceability and broad aftermarket support. The suspension and braking systems were engineered around the demands expected of a truck in this class, and the body-on-frame construction was standard for the segment.
